Search found 15 matches

by 0136
Tue Nov 18, 2008 4:35 pm
Forum: Kernel
Topic: ОЗУ
Replies: 12
Views: 17301

Re: ОЗУ

офф топ, про пень2 это не так, вот карта памяти с 64 мб:

1) 0, 9FC00h, 1
2) 9fc00h, 400h, 1
3) 0f0000h, 01000h, 2
4) 0FFFF0000h, 10000h, 2
5) 100000h, 0E00000h, 1
6) 0F00000h, 100000h, 2

и вот с 486 с 16 метрами озу:
1) 0, 9fc00h, 1
2) 100000h, 700000h, 1
3) 800000h, 800000h, 2
by 0136
Tue Nov 18, 2008 12:35 pm
Forum: Kernel
Topic: ОЗУ
Replies: 12
Views: 17301

Re: ОЗУ

Хотите сказать что это нормально из 64 мб доступно 651264 байт?
by 0136
Tue Nov 18, 2008 2:52 am
Forum: Kernel
Topic: ОЗУ
Replies: 12
Views: 17301

Re: ОЗУ

На некоторых машинах, ф-я выдаёт смешные результаты. Вот, решил спросить как у вас и поднял этот вопрос на васме http://www.wasm.ru/forum/viewtopic.php?id=29699
by 0136
Mon Nov 17, 2008 11:17 pm
Forum: Kernel
Topic: ОЗУ
Replies: 12
Views: 17301

Re: ОЗУ

наверное это правильно, потому что я пользуюсь ф-ей Е820 int 15h, и её результаты иногда просто издевательство!!!
by 0136
Mon Nov 17, 2008 9:27 pm
Forum: Kernel
Topic: ОЗУ
Replies: 12
Views: 17301

я так понял это: xor edi, edi mov ebx, 'TEST' @@: add edi, 0x100000 xchg ebx, dword [edi] cmp dword [edi], 'TEST' xchg ebx, dword [edi] je @b mov [MEM_AMOUNT-OS_BASE], edi Но есть ведь участки памяти которые нельзя юзать, или пофиг? Обьясните пожалуйста :)
by 0136
Mon Nov 17, 2008 8:48 pm
Forum: Kernel
Topic: ОЗУ
Replies: 12
Views: 17301

ОЗУ

Привет, скажите, как колибри определяет обьём озу, и пользуется ли она ф-ей int 15h E820h?
by 0136
Mon Jun 23, 2008 7:15 pm
Forum: Miscellaneous
Topic: таблица 866 и вроде ср1251
Replies: 1
Views: 2542

таблица 866 и вроде ср1251

Привет всем! У кого для функци есть такое - ; A TABL1 DB 00000000B DB 00000000B DB 00011110B DB 00110110B DB 01100110B DB 11000110B DB 11000110B DB 11111110B DB 11000110B DB 11000110B DB 11000110B DB 11000110B DB 00000000B DB 00000000B DB 00000000B DB 00000000B ; Ѓ DB 00000000B DB 00000000B DB 11111...
by 0136
Fri Mar 07, 2008 12:19 am
Forum: Coding
Topic: Список выдаваемых сканов клавиатуры
Replies: 5
Views: 7956

Re: Список выдаваемых сканов клавиатуры

хорошо, например клавиша "Win" какой скан выдаёт? И другие... ???
by 0136
Thu Mar 06, 2008 3:10 pm
Forum: Coding
Topic: Список выдаваемых сканов клавиатуры
Replies: 5
Views: 7956

Список выдаваемых сканов клавиатуры

Привет! Покажите список сканов и ASCII кодов выдаваемых клавиатурой или подскажите в каком файле ос это можно посмотреть.
by 0136
Thu Dec 27, 2007 6:01 pm
Forum: Drivers
Topic: быстрое возбухание таймера = GP13
Replies: 15
Views: 20445

Re: быстрое возбухание таймера = GP13

привет, точно, сделал IRQ7, и оно возникает %). И нафиг такое железо глючное в комп поставили? 8) Ладно, всем спасибо.
by 0136
Wed Dec 26, 2007 4:12 am
Forum: Drivers
Topic: быстрое возбухание таймера = GP13
Replies: 15
Views: 20445

Re: быстрое возбухание таймера = GP13

diamond, а ведь не может быть IRQ7, оно у меня запрещено, при настройке кПр-й:

mov al, 11111100b ; OCW1, 0 - разрешено прерывание, 1 - запрещено
out 21h, al

mov al, 11111111b ; OCW1, маска
out 0A1h, al

окроме таймера и клавиатуры прерываний больше нет тчк

Есть такой, кто скажет правду???
by 0136
Mon Dec 17, 2007 1:11 pm
Forum: Drivers
Topic: быстрое возбухание таймера = GP13
Replies: 15
Views: 20445

Re: быстрое возбухание таймера = GP13

Спасибо за инфу, буду думать! Тестировал на мсдосе ;) . Сразу возникает вопрос - если так, так это получается, если, подключить устройство, очень быстрое, например, которое будет подавать сигналы с частотой в 10 Мгц, то фиг можно будет их быстро обработать? Получается их можно обработать с частотой ...
by 0136
Sun Dec 16, 2007 9:23 pm
Forum: Drivers
Topic: быстрое возбухание таймера = GP13
Replies: 15
Views: 20445

Re: быстрое возбухание таймера = GP13

diamond, там с самого начала написано - сегмент кода, 32 разрядный, seg_code32 segment use32. код команды iret = CF, у тебя что фасм ставит префикс??? Нафиг префикс??? Чё ты придумал??? Не в этом ошибка :) Спасибо за твою внимательность и за желание помочь :)
by 0136
Sun Dec 16, 2007 8:49 pm
Forum: Drivers
Topic: быстрое возбухание таймера = GP13
Replies: 15
Views: 20445

Re: быстрое возбухание таймера = GP13

diamond, спасибо за совет, но, во первых, он не по теме, во вторых, как ты пипой не крути, ирет получишь ты, пофиг iret или iretd, у меня бит D во всег дескрипторах означает 32-й режим, когда iret, то это значит что он работает с 32-ми данными тчк. То что в коде моём ошибок куча, то такое. А вот поч...
by 0136
Sun Dec 16, 2007 12:55 am
Forum: Drivers
Topic: быстрое возбухание таймера = GP13
Replies: 15
Views: 20445

быстрое возбухание таймера = GP13

Ребята, всем привет, может я не по теме, но думаю тут много профессионалов, прошу подсказать - настраиваю таймер, на большую частоту: ; Повышение частоты таймера xor ax, ax mov al, 00110110b ; канал 0, режим 3, вид операции 3, счёт двоичный out 43h, al ;!!!!!!!!!!!!!!!!! mov ax, 02 ; значение фиксат...